How much do part time data processing j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 2,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time data processing in Indiana is $18.52,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.81 and $20.58 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are part time data processing jobs?

Part time data processing jobs involve handling, organizing, and managing data on a flexible or reduced-hour schedule. These roles typically require entering, updating, and verifying data in computer systems or databases. Common tasks may include data entry, cleaning up existing information, or generating reports. Part time positions are ideal for students, parents, or anyone seeking work-life balance, and can be found in various industries such as healthcare, finance, and retail.

What is the difference between Part Time Data Processing vs Part Time Data Entry?

AspectPart Time Data ProcessingPart Time Data Entry
CredentialsBasic computer skills, familiarity with data processing softwareBasic computer skills, proficiency in typing and data entry tools
Work EnvironmentRemote or office-based, handling data files and softwareRemote or office-based, entering data into spreadsheets or databases
Industry UsageBusiness, finance, healthcare, and tech sectorsAdministrative, retail, healthcare, and customer service sectors

Part Time Data Processing involves managing and analyzing data using specialized software, often requiring some familiarity with data management tools. Part Time Data Entry focuses on inputting data into systems, emphasizing typing speed and accuracy. While both roles are often remote and require basic computer skills, data processing may involve more technical tasks, whereas data entry is more straightforward and clerical. Job description

Labcorp is seeking a Specimen Processor I to join our team in Fort Wayne, IN.

Work Schedule: Monday – Friday 3:00pm – 11:30pm, and rotating Saturdays

 Job Responsibilities:

  • Prepare laboratory specimens for analysis and testing

  • Unpack and route specimens to their respective staging areas

  • Accurately identify and label specimens 

  • Pack and ship specimens to proper testing facilities 

  • Meet department activity and production goals

  • Properly prepare and store excess specimen samples 

  • Data entry of patient information in an accurate and timely manner 

  • Resolve and document any problem specimens 

Minimum Qualifications:

  • High School Diploma or equivalent

Preferred Qualifications:

  • 1 or more years relative experience (lab/accessioning, production/manufacturing/warehouse environment)

Additional Job Standards:

  • Comfortable handling biological specimens 

  • Ability to accurately identify specimens 

  • Experience working in a team environment 

  • Strong data entry and organizational skills

  • High level of attention to detail

  • Proficient in MS Office 

  • Ability to lift up to 40lbs.

  • Ability to pass a standardized color blind test
